Have your say on the future of the Blaenavon World Heritage Site
A series of public consultation events that will allow residents to shape a new Management Plan for the Blaenavon Industrial Landscape World Heritage Site are being held in February.
The informal drop in sessions will allow residents to give their ideas for how the site can be best managed for the benefit of the landscape, building conservation, health and wellbeing, and economic development.

Blaenavon Heritage Town secures National Lottery support
Torfaen council has received initial National Lottery funding support of £35,500 from the Heritage Lottery Fund (HLF) for a project to tackle the poor condition of key properties within the town’s main commercial area in Broad Street by offering grant support for conservation based works.
As well as supporting property improvements, the local community will have the chance to get involved in a variety of exciting local volunteer opportunities and community events that explore the rich social history associated with the development of the town. Blaenavon Town Council will also be supporting the project.

Match Funding Bid Success for Blaenavon
Blaenavon Town Council is supporting match funding to help preserve and promote use of historic buildings within the town, at meeting held on 25th Jan the Council supported bids via the Rural Development Programme for Blaenavon Workmens Hall, Bethlehem Chapel and Busy Bees in Park Street Chapel. Mayor of Blaenavon Alan Jones said “It’s vital not only to preserve these landmarks but also to ensure their expanded use within the town”
